JDraw is a free, open-source diagramming and vector graphics editor for Windows, Mac and Linux. It allows users to create flowcharts, UML diagrams, network diagrams, mockups, floor plans and more. Key features include a simple and intuitive interface, extensive shape libraries, advanced styling and formatting options.

PocketBase is an open-source, self-hosted database that is easy to set up and manage. It is lightweight, fast, and allows real-time data syncing across devices. Useful for small-scale projects that need simple database functionality.
